Why an Above Ground Swimming Pool Pump Timer Is Necessary
I’ve found that an above ground swimming pool pump timer is one of the simplest ways to keep my pool clean without having to think about it all the time. It automatically controls when the pump turns on and off, so my water keeps circulating regularly even when I’m busy. That steady circulation helps prevent dirt, debris, and algae from building up, which makes my pool much easier to maintain.
My biggest reason for using a timer is energy savings. Instead of running the pump all day, I can set it to work only during the hours that are actually needed. That lowers my electricity use and helps reduce my monthly bills. It also gives me peace of mind because I know the pump is running on a consistent schedule, which helps protect the pool system from unnecessary wear.
I also like how a timer makes pool care more convenient. I don’t have to remember to switch the pump on or off manually, and I can enjoy my pool more without extra hassle. For me, it’s a small device that makes a big difference in keeping my above ground pool clean, efficient, and easy to manage.

2. What I Look For in a Pool Pump Timer
When I shop for a timer, I focus on a few key things:
- Compatibility: I make sure the timer works with my pump’s voltage and amperage.
- Weather resistance: Since it will be outdoors, I prefer a model built to handle rain, heat, and humidity.
- Ease of programming: I want a timer that is simple to set without complicated steps.
- Manual override: I like having the option to turn the pump on or off manually when needed.
- Durability: I look for a timer that feels sturdy and is made to last through pool season after pool season.
3. Mechanical vs. Digital Timers
In my experience, the choice between mechanical and digital timers depends on how much control I want.
- Mechanical timers: These are usually simple, reliable, and easy for me to understand. I like them when I want basic on/off scheduling.
- Digital timers: These give me more precise control and often more scheduling options. I prefer them if I want flexibility and better accuracy.
If I want something straightforward, I lean toward mechanical. If I want more features, I choose digital.
4. Checking Electrical Requirements
This is one area I never skip. I always check the voltage and amperage of my pool pump before buying a timer. If the timer is not rated properly, it can cause problems or fail too soon. I also make sure the installation matches local electrical codes. If I am unsure, I get help from a qualified electrician because safety matters more than saving a little money.
5. Features That Make Life Easier for Me
Some features I find especially useful include:
- Multiple daily cycles: Helpful if I want the pump to run at different times.
- 24-hour scheduling: Lets me set a full daily routine.
- Battery backup: Keeps settings saved during power outages.
- Lockable cover: Adds protection and prevents accidental changes.
- Clear display or markings: Makes setup much easier for me.
6. Installation Considerations I Keep in Mind
Before buying, I think about where the timer will be installed. I want it mounted in a convenient location near the pump and power source, but still protected from direct exposure when possible. I also check whether the timer comes with installation instructions and mounting hardware. If installation looks complicated, I factor in the cost of professional help.
7. My Budget Advice
I have found that the cheapest timer is not always the best value. A low-cost model may work fine at first, but if it is not durable or weather-resistant, I may end up replacing it sooner. I usually try to balance price with reliability. For me, spending a little more on a dependable timer is worth it because it can save money over time.
